as some of you might have heard we are planning to get qtbase's winrt
branch integrated to dev in order to have a tech preview available at 
least for that part of Qt. In order to have it reviewed properly it 
would be awesome if some of you could have a look at the "winrt" topic
branch 
(https://codereview.qt-project.org/#q,status:open+project:qt/qtbase+branch:dev+topic:winrt,n,z)
and review changes there. Every other feedback is of course welcome as well.

We are still struggling with the network part of the code. I am
somewhat lost about how to activate socket notifiers for the port.
It looks like I can listen on ports and connect to servers but
example do not work. Neithger googlesuggest nor fortuneserver/-client
give any output. The WIP network change can be found here
https://codereview.qt-project.org/#change,64822 The approach to handling
sockets changed fundamentally so that mapping the options to the new
approach isn't always trivial.

The part I seem to be struggling with most is activating socket
notifiers as soon as something can be read from/written to a socket.
Handling of these events should done in qnativesocketengine_winrt.cpp 
(about line 417) but I don't know how to trigger something for the
notifiers from there. Ossi suggested to give the information about
data being available back to the event loop and have it handled there
but I could not find a way on how to do that. My issue basically seems
to be that the sockets do not know about their notifiers and I seem
unable to make a connection the other way around. Any input on that
problem would be highly appreciated :)
